A GEM HUGE, 4-1/4" CLASSIC Lee Creek Carcharocles chubutensis, a C. megalodon predecessor - upper jaw Principal Anterior tooth. LC006 is an absolute monster sized Chubutensis tooth. This tooth was found in the Pungo River Formation (middle Miocene age). Note that the crown exhibits small cusplike bumps at the base of the serrated edge and the root ends also show grooves where the teeth interlocked. These are characteristic traits of the Lee Creek early Meg - C. chubutensis. A gorgeous light tan colored crown with an excellent tan bourlette. The bourlette is 100% complete. No enamel peel. The serrations are long, razor sharp, and essentially complete including a good tip serration. Highest quality enamel! The root is an excellent light tan color and complete. A very rare, early Otodus aksuaticus anterior tooth from Kzil-Orda, Kazakhstan. A transitional tooth leading to O. auriculatus (see detailed discussion below) which leads to Megalodon. The bourlette is complete. This tooth exhibits small serrations along the lower 1/2 of the crown and micro serrations to the tip. These teeth exhibit excellent color, gloss, and preservation. A rare, early (Ypresian) Eocene Auriculatus transition tooth. A very challenging tooth to find when building a Megalodon evolutionary set! No repair or restoration. Authenticity guaranteed. This western Kazakhstan site is one of the few places in the world where the Otodus obliquus to Otodus auriculatus transition can be found in adjacent geologic layers.

A rare, ~3" GEM Great White transition shark tooth, Carcharodon hubbelli, from Chile. The C. hubbelli is an evolutionary transition from the non-serrated big-tooth Mako shark to the fully serrated Great White shark which takes place in the late Miocene period.
